Introduction

Manual accessibility testing is highly labor-intensive and prone to human error, often creating severe bottlenecks in agile release cycles. Delivering an inclusive web experience that accommodates all users, including those relying on assistive technologies, requires constant vigilance. However, checking every single component by hand cannot scale.

Automated accessibility software addresses this specific pain point by scanning for baseline compliance violations early in the development pipeline. This shift minimizes the repetitive, time-consuming effort required by QA teams. By identifying structural and code-level accessibility failures automatically, engineering teams can focus their manual testing hours primarily on nuanced, context-dependent user experience evaluations.

Buyer Considerations

When evaluating accessibility automation software, buyers must verify whether the tool maps directly to established WCAG standards. Without close adherence to the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ines, organizations risk investing in software that fails to ensure true regulatory compliance. Tools must identify which specific WCAG rules are being violated to provide actionable feedback.

It is also important to assess if the software integrates natively into existing CI/CD pipelines. Standalone accessibility scanners often create more manual work through data silos, requiring teams to export reports and manually create tickets. A unified platform that triggers accessibility checks alongside regular functional tests is important for a seamless developer experience.

Finally, teams should consider the tradeoff between fully autonomous scans and the necessity of real-device validation. While automation handles the bulk of the work, verifying native screen readers requires actual hardware. Frequently Asked Questions

Can automated software completely replace manual accessibility testing?

While automation efficiently catches the vast majority of baseline WCAG violations, manual checks using DevTools or real screen readers remain necessary for nuanced, context-dependent user experience validation.

How does an accessibility testing agent integrate with existing pipelines?

Modern cloud platforms allow AI-powered accessibility agents to run automatically during continuous integration, flagging compliance issues and preventing inaccessible code from merging into production.

What standards do accessibility automation tools check against?

Leading accessibility automation tools automatically detect software issues based on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) compliance standards.

Does cloud-based accessibility testing support real mobile devices?

Yes, unified testing platforms provide access to real device clouds, allowing QA teams to verify mobile accessibility features natively on actual iOS and Android hardware.
